Programming with categories
WebVarious categories of programming languages influence how people work, play, and otherwise interact with each other. Innovative technologies such as smartphone apps, … Webusing universal constructs in category theory (“diagram chasing”). The category of logics - theorem provers in different logic systems can be hooked together through ‘institution morphisms’ Functional Programming - type theory, programming language semantics, etc
Programming with categories
Did you know?
WebOct 6, 2024 · Category theory is a treasure trove of extremelyuseful programming ideas. Haskell programmers have been tapping this resource for a long time, and the ideas are … http://www.brendanfong.com/programmingcats_files/cats4progs-DRAFT.pdf
WebDescription. This course is designed to teach programmers how to use ChatGPT, a revolutionary tool that can aid them in creating, fixing, and improving their code. The course is divided into seven sections that cover a range of topics related to using ChatGPT in programming. In Section 1, you will be introduced to the course and the tool. WebApr 10, 2024 · Matlab is a numerical computing platform and programming language with a strong focus on multi-dimensional arrays and linear algebra. In this post I examine the array types in matlab and discuss their design. Matlab’s Array Types. Matlab has two primary array types, the matrix and the cell array. The matrix is a dynamic array of contiguous ...
WebAug 12, 2024 · Prolog, Absys, Alice, ASP, etc., are logic programming languages. Different Types of Programming Languages Now that we're done with programming paradigms, let's look at programming languages from the perspective of how humans and computers understand them. Using this perspective, we can classify programming languages into 3 … WebTo begin with, you'll learn why Rust is such a prominent and popular programming language to learn in 2024. The course then walks you through downloading, installing and creating a nice set up. From here, the basics of the programming language are taught including cargo tools, variables, constants, shadowing, data types, functions and much more.
WebJan 7, 2024 · 19 Programming with Categories Programming with Categories - Lecture 3 11K views 3 years ago 15 Applied Category Theory (@ MIT 2024) Topos Institute …
WebOct 17, 2024 · Here are 11 types of programming jobs to consider pursuing: 1. Web developer National average salary: $67,712 per year Primary duties: Web developers design and create websites. They're responsible for both how the site looks and how it functions. They test and evaluate a site to make sure it meets quality standards before its release. spanish 40WebMay 26, 2024 · Object Oriented programming organizes code by creating types in the form of classes. These classes contain the code that represents a specific entity. The BankAccount class represents a bank account. The code implements specific operations through methods and properties. In this tutorial, the bank account supports this behavior: spanish 400Web# The MIT 2024 Lectures: Programming with Categories. This series of lectures (course material (opens new window)) brings together Mathematicians David Spivak, Brendan … tearing effect output lineWeb2 days ago · The $16-per-month service, called Max, will be released May 23 in the U.S. and automatically replace the company’s existing HBO Max service in what is being promised … tearing emojiWebProgramming is the mental process of thinking up instructions to give to a machine (like a computer). Coding is the process of transforming those ideas into a written language that … spanish 410 folding shotgunWebSep 21, 2024 · Built-in types. C# provides a standard set of built-in types. These represent integers, floating point values, Boolean expressions, text characters, decimal values, and … spanish 410 double barrel shotguns for saleWebFeb 7, 2024 · See the different types of programming languages and find a programming languages list of the most commonly used languages. Updated: 02/07/2024 Table of … tear in german